What PM Kisan Scheme Is All About

The PM Kisan Samman Nidhi Yojana was started by the Central Government to give financial support to small and marginal farmers. Under this scheme, eligible farmers get ₹6,000 every year, divided into three installments of ₹2,000 each.

The money is sent directly into their bank accounts through the Direct Benefit Transfer (DBT) system. This helps farmers manage their daily expenses, buy seeds, fertilizers, and other farming essentials.

How Farmers Can Check Their Payment Status

Farmers can easily check their payment status by visiting the official website pmkisan.gov.in. After opening the site, they just need to click on “Beneficiary Status”, enter their Aadhaar or mobile number, and the screen will show whether the installment has been sent or not.

Many farmers prefer visiting their local bank branch to confirm the credit directly.
